Ethical Deliberation in the Intensive Care Unit: Impact of Formalized Multidisciplinary Team Meetings, a Pilot Study.

Summary
Most patients who die in the intensive care unit do so after a withholding or withdrawing of life sustaining treatments (WWLST) decision.
The implementation of formalized interdisciplinary team meetings for ethical deliberation in the ICU may improve nurses participation in WWLST decisions.
The investigators decided to implement such team meetings in their ICU.
At this occasion, the investigators will measure job satisfaction, job related frustration and ethical decision making climate climate.
